Black Cat Reading and Training is a 6-level series of richly illustrated readers suitable for older teenagers, young adults and adults. It offers original stories and retold classics, both fiction and non-fiction. Each title integrates a story with four-skills activities written in the style of Cambridge ESOL examinations, as well as informative background information to provide students with an enjoyable and rewarding, all-in-one reading experience. Audio recordings are available for all titles.

This book contains four English detective stories: two from the 19th century and two from the 20th century. In Conan Doyle's "The Five Orange Pips", Sherlock Holmes battles against a criminal organization. In Charles Dickens' "Hunted Down", a ruthless murderer is brought to Justice. In Clarence Rook's "The Stir Outside the Cafe Royal", a woman tracks down her fiancee's killer. And in G.K. Chesterton's "The Oracle of the Dog", Father Brown solves a difficult murder case.
